Если вы запустите --profile=report.json
, вы получите файл JSON, содержащий все данные, которые входят в профилирование.Исходя из этого, должно быть довольно легко сгенерировать вывод GraphViz.Если есть спрос, режим генерации GraphViz может быть добавлен к --profile
.
. Однако, как показывает предыдущий опыт, файл GraphViz со всеми зависимостями слишком велик, чтобы его можно было просматривать на практике.Чтобы сделать представление графика практичным, вам нужно либо сгруппировать / отфильтровать график, либо использовать лучший просмотрщик графиков.